The local climate functions warm, high-humidity summer seasons together with crisp, cool winters, producing a distinct set of difficulties for traditional turf ranges. Popular local turfs like Buffalo, Kikuyu, and Sofa react dramatically to seasonal shifts. Throughout the peak growing season from November through March, the mix of regular rainfall and warm temperature levels triggers lawns to shoot up rapidly. Regular intervention is needed during these months to prevent the turf from ending up being uncontrollable and suffocating itself. Letting the turf grow too long between cuts blocks essential sunlight from reaching the lower blades, which ultimately results in patchy, yellowed areas and a weakened lawn structure.
Using the right mowing method is just as important as how often you mow if you desire your lawn to remain healthy. A frequent error lots of homeowners make is "scalping" the yard cutting it too low wishing to extend the period between cuts. When the grass is excessively short, the tender roots are exposed to extreme midday heat, triggering soil moisture to evaporate rapidly and making the lawn more susceptible to weed intrusions. A practical standard for a lot of lawns is to never ever trim off more than one‑third of the blade length in one go. Preserving the turf at a somewhat higher, constant height promotes much deeper rooting, improves the soil's ability to hold water throughout dry periods, and forms a natural shield versus aggressive weeds such as summertime grass and bindii.

The condition of your lawn is greatly influenced by the tools you use to take care of it. When mower blades pall, they rip the lawn instead of sufficing easily, leaving ragged, brown suggestions that give the entire yard a thirsty, lack‑luster look. Those rough edges likewise make the lawn vulnerable to fungal infections, which can rapidly sweep through a wet lawn after a heavy rain. Keeping your equipment in good check here shape and adjusting the lawn mower deck to the appropriate height for each season can significantly improve the turf's durability with time. For instance, raising the cutting height a bit in the fall allows the lawn to capture more sunshine as days shorten, helping it construct strength to withstand the inactive cold weather.
